Can someone provide an example of how to use an ID in Webflow?

Published on
September 22, 2023

Sure! Here's an example of how you can use an ID in Webflow:

  1. Create an element: Start by adding an HTML element to your Webflow project. This can be any type of element, such as a section, div, or button.

  2. Set an ID: Select the element and go to the Settings panel on the right-hand side. Under the "Element Settings" tab, you'll find an "ID" field. Enter a unique ID for the element. It's important to choose a descriptive and relevant ID name for better readability and organization. For example, you can use "my-section" or "contact-button" as IDs.

  3. Use the ID in custom code: Once you've set the ID for your element, you can now use it in custom code. Webflow allows you to add custom code through the "Custom Code" section in the Project Settings. Let's say you want to add a smooth scroll effect to your button. You can use JavaScript code to achieve this. Here's an example of how you can target the element using its ID:

    ```javascript
    document.getElementById("contact-button").addEventListener("click", function() {
    document.getElementById("my-section").scrollIntoView({ behavior: 'smooth' });
    });
    ```

    In the above code, we're using the getElementById method to select the button element with the ID "contact-button". Then, we're adding an event listener to listen for the click event on the button. When the button is clicked, we're scrolling the element with the ID "my-section" into view with a smooth scrolling effect.

Using IDs in Webflow is a powerful way to target specific elements and customize their behavior using custom code. It allows you to enhance the functionality and interactivity of your Webflow project.

Summary:
To use an ID in Webflow, follow these steps:

  1. Create an element
  2. Set an ID for the element in the Settings panel
  3. Use the ID in custom code to target and manipulate the element

Example questions for search engine optimization:

  1. How can I use an ID in Webflow?
  2. What's an example of using an ID in Webflow?
  3. How to target elements with IDs in Webflow?